Controls Service Engineer.

Ideally based in the Midlands.

You will be based working from home, with travel to customer sites.

  • As a Controls Service Engineer for fully automated intralogistics systems, you take on a key role in operational operations.
  • Your main tasks include on-call services, where you intervene quickly and efficiently in the event of disruptions. You provide remote 2nd and 3rd level support to ensure that the systems function smoothly.
  • You will independently implement smaller projects and contribute your extensive specialist knowledge.
  • Creating detailed documentation is also part of your responsibilities, and you actively share your knowledge with the team to support colleagues.
  • You will travel flexibly to help with customer problems on site or to support the implementation of projects if necessary.
  • Your contribution is crucial to ensure the smooth functionality of the systems and to provide the customer with the best possible support.

What you need to succeed

  • For the position of Controls Service Engineer, you have completed a degree, further training as a technician, master craftsman or a comparable qualification in the field of electrical engineering, automation technology or mechatronics.
  • You have in-depth experience in PLC programming, especially with TIA, S7 or Beckhoff TwinCat2/3, as well as extensive knowledge of fieldbuses, HMI systems and frequency converters.
  • Your ability to read electrical circuit diagrams, combined with practical experience in troubleshooting electrical and control technology, sets you apart.
  • It goes without saying that you are confident in using common Office applications.
  • Your willingness to continue training as well as your strong teamwork and communication skills make you a valuable member of our team.

About Swisslog

Swisslog is shaping the future of intralogistics.

As part of the KUKA Group, we work on the latest technologies that are reimagining the world of logistics.

We’re a team of 2,900 experts from 50 countries, serving some of the world's largest and most exciting brands.

Together, we’re implementing smart and innovative approaches - including flexible robot-based and data-driven automation solutions that are transforming the supply chain.
